Understanding Peptide Synthesis: Why Consistency Matters

Knowing that peptide synthesis is essential for advancing laboratory research, the standard of peptides produced plays a major role in experimental outcomes. Because peptides serve as critical biomolecules, precise synthesis methods are needed to confirm their operational effectiveness and utility in various fields. Elements like cleanliness, length, and molecular composition are important, since even small deviations can cause inaccurate data. High-quality peptides support reliable molecular interactions, correct conformations, and exact biological activity, rendering them indispensable for studies in areas such as biochemistry and molecular biology. Researchers must give priority to strict quality control throughout synthesis, incorporating analytical techniques like mass spectrometry and high-performance liquid chromatography. By stressing the significance of quality in peptide synthesis, research labs can boost the reproducibility and accuracy of their findings, thereby supporting the growth of scientific knowledge and innovation. This focus on standards is fundamental in producing impactful research results.
